Output 74d815603381c6bfcb0f51a055f6c8c025401b7b8eb973f69bbdb59bf741081a:0

value
822896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29442712eb93819246764b89a8bc2b94b25e980 OP_EQUAL
address
3NM4F9he3PtQt2kPSNbAaCQmVC7CzZtX8c
transaction
74d815603381c6bfcb0f51a055f6c8c025401b7b8eb973f69bbdb59bf741081a
confirmations
252806
spent
true